Output 58cfd3828ca1852001b6f18dfeef802492d8f30727599c3e93507d3e287426f6:1

value
83773858
script pubkey
OP_0 OP_PUSHBYTES_20 a7af02d42b4bbd0d2533d524e8f3af5e90f7fe5a
address
bc1q57hs94ptfw7s6ffn65jw3ua0t6g00lj65luhl8
transaction
58cfd3828ca1852001b6f18dfeef802492d8f30727599c3e93507d3e287426f6